Clone Tools
  • last updated a few seconds 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
Change more tests.

    • -3
    • +3
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 20 more files in changeset.
Change more tests.

  1. … 13 more files in changeset.
Changed a bunch of integration tests to use the various task assertion methods instead of directly querying the `executedTasks` and `skippedTasks` collections. These methods can give better diagnostics when the assertion fails, and can perform additional checks.

    • -3
    • +3
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 50 more files in changeset.
Changed a bunch of integration tests to use the various task assertion methods instead of directly querying the `executedTasks` and `skippedTasks` collections. These methods can give better diagnostics when the assertion fails, and can perform additional checks.

    • -10
    • +10
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 96 more files in changeset.
Changed a bunch of integration tests to use the various task assertion methods instead of directly querying the `executedTasks` and `skippedTasks` collections. These methods can give better diagnostics when the assertion fails, and can perform additional checks.

    • -10
    • +10
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 96 more files in changeset.
Changed a bunch of integration tests to use the various task assertion methods instead of directly querying the `executedTasks` and `skippedTasks` collections. These methods can give better diagnostics when the assertion fails, and can perform additional checks.

    • -3
    • +3
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 50 more files in changeset.
Changed a bunch of integration tests to use the various task assertion methods instead of directly querying the `executedTasks` and `skippedTasks` collections. These methods can give better diagnostics when the assertion fails, and can perform additional checks.

    • -10
    • +10
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 96 more files in changeset.
Let jacoco tests not use deprecated configurations

    • -1
    • +1
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
Let jacoco tests not use deprecated configurations

    • -1
    • +1
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
Let jacoco tests not use deprecated configurations

    • -1
    • +1
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
Let jacoco tests not use deprecated configurations

    • -1
    • +1
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
Fix tests and checkstyle

    • -4
    • +6
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 1 more file in changeset.
Remove another call to append

    • -1
    • +0
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
Deprecate jacoco.append

It makes no sense to set the property to `false`.

  1. … 2 more files in changeset.
Fix Jacoco to work with build cache

Jacoco code coverage should work well with the build cache out of the

box. Since appending to a coverage file works with parallel test

execution, see https://github.com/jacoco/jacoco/pull/52, we set

`append=true` and delete the coverage data just before the test task

starts to execute.

Note that this is a breaking change: separate tasks now cannot use the

same coverage file, since each of the tasks will delete it.

Issue: #5269

    • -4
    • +9
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 2 more files in changeset.
Rework JacocoReportBase to avoid use of afterEvaluate

  1. … 2 more files in changeset.
Re-enable Jacoco test for Java9 (#5557)

    • -1
    • +1
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
  1. … 1 more file in changeset.
Dogfood ImmutableFileCollection on production code (#4988)

This reverts commit 13eaebc2b1244511dcbff4c59cd41253e3b69642.

  1. … 88 more files in changeset.
Revert "Dogfood ImmutableFileCollection on production code (#4988)"

This reverts commit 834632674ca29b6fd190857947338b2b54a9bb62.

The commit caused a bug in incremental compilation, causing changes

to go undetected.

  1. … 88 more files in changeset.
Dogfood ImmutableFileCollection on production code (#4988)

Use ImmutableFileCollection in production code

  1. … 88 more files in changeset.
Change int tests to use relevant fixture methods to express their expectations about the build log output.

    • -1
    • +1
    ./testing/jacoco/plugins/JacocoPluginMultiVersionIntegrationTest.groovy
    • -1
    • +1
    ./testing/jacoco/plugins/rules/JacocoPluginCoverageVerificationIncompatibleVersionIntegrationTest.groovy
  1. … 28 more files in changeset.
Change int tests to use relevant fixture methods to express their expectations about the build log output.

  1. … 22 more files in changeset.
Allow ArgumentProviders be passed as Test/JavaExec Jvm arguments (#4300)

* Allow ArgumentProviders be passed to Test Jvm arguments

* Make it possible to pass argument providers to JavaExec

  1. … 26 more files in changeset.
Allow enabling build cache in all integration tests

Signed-off-by: Lóránt Pintér <lorant@gradle.com>

  1. … 27 more files in changeset.
Convert existing relocation tests to use new one (#3782)

  1. … 9 more files in changeset.
Use mavenCentral() and jcenter() mirrors in tests where possible

  1. … 51 more files in changeset.
Check that cached jacoco report is the same

Activate test which is now implemented

Do not restore file dates when unpacking task outputs (#2667)

  1. … 5 more files in changeset.
Add coverage for Test tasks being cachable with Jacoco disabled

+review REVIEW-6522